Unquestionably, marble ranks Among the many most high-class and delightful countertop and flooring supplies. Equally over and above query is The point that marble necessitates Specific care and servicing.

Marble is usually a purely natural stone materials that is certainly rather porous. Without the need of right sealing, the stone will function like a sponge.

This specialised products is engineered to work on marble (travertine or limestone way too) that was originally polished to a shine. So, it restores a ruined shiny finish, but is inadequate to make that glow from Uncooked marble to start with.

Thankfully, etched sections of marble can often be restored with specialised polishing powders. With regards to the sizing and severity in the etched section, these powders may perhaps either buff out small blemishes or need recurring applications about an prolonged stretch of time to absolutely restore a closely broken section.

The strategy and/or products needed to mend etch marks depends on the type of complete around the marble.

Gentle supplies which include chamois cloths and dust mops will safeguard your marble much better than abrasive brushes and sponges. Dry erasers are particularly inadvisable given that they work by abrading surfaces to wash them.

Don’t soak your marble floor in cleaning Answer. Wring any extra liquid out of your mop or fabric right before washing the floor.

Since marble is made out of loads of various aspects, some marbles consist of metals that might cause stains to appear about the floor of your respective floor. Iron, copper, and bronze are all found in marble and may stain whenever click here they get wet. Hunt for reddish brown or inexperienced patches to discover them.
